Features and Capabilities of Fusion 360
Fusion 360 offers a wide range of features and capabilities that make it a popular choice among designers, engineers, and hobbyists alike. Some key features of Fusion 360 include:
- Parametric Modeling: Fusion 360 allows you to create 3D models using parametric techniques, enabling you to easily modify designs by changing parameters such as dimensions, materials, or constraints.
- Assembly Design: With Fusion 360, you can create complex assemblies by bringing together multiple parts and components. The software provides tools for designing joints, constraints, and motion studies, helping you visualize the functioning of your assemblies.
- Simulation and Analysis: Fusion 360 includes simulation and analysis tools that enable you to test the performance and behavior of your designs under various conditions. This helps in identifying potential issues and optimizing designs before they are physically produced.
- Generative Design: One of the standout features of Fusion 360 is its generative design capabilities. By defining constraints and objectives, the software can automatically generate optimized designs, often resulting in innovative and efficient solutions.
- Collaboration and Cloud Integration: Fusion 360 is a cloud-based software, which means you can access your designs and collaborate with team members from anywhere, using any device with an internet connection. This makes it convenient for distributed teams or individuals working on projects remotely.
- CAM and CNC Machining: Fusion 360 offers integrated computer-aided manufacturing (CAM) tools that allow you to generate toolpaths and machine your designs using computer numerical control (CNC) machines. This seamless integration between CAD and CAM reduces the need for data translation and streamlines the manufacturing process.
Industries and Applications
Fusion 360 finds applications in a wide range of industries due to its versatility and comprehensive feature set. Some notable industries where Fusion 360 is commonly used include:
- Product Design and Development: Fusion 360 is widely used for product design, from conceptualization to manufacturing. Its parametric modeling, simulation, and collaboration features make it an ideal tool for iterating on design ideas and bringing products to market efficiently.
- Architecture and Construction: Architects and construction professionals utilize Fusion 360 for creating detailed 3D models of buildings, visualizing spaces, and generating construction documentation. The software’s ability to handle large-scale designs and collaborate with project stakeholders simplifies the design and construction processes.
- Mechanical and Industrial Engineering: Fusion 360’s capabilities in parametric modeling, assembly design, and simulation make it a valuable tool for mechanical and industrial engineers. It aids in designing complex machinery, analyzing performance, and optimizing designs for efficiency.
- 3D Printing and Prototyping: Fusion 360’s support for additive manufacturing techniques, combined with its generative design capabilities, makes it a go-to choice for 3D printing enthusiasts and prototypers. The software enables the creation of intricate and optimized designs suitable for 3D printing.
Frequently Asked Questions (FAQ)
Here are some commonly asked questions about learning Fusion 360:
1. Is Fusion 360 suitable for beginners? Yes, Fusion 360 is beginner-friendly. Its intuitive user interface and extensive learning resources, such as tutorials and community forums, make it accessible for users with varying levels of CAD experience.
2. Can I use Fusion 360 for personal projects? Absolutely! Fusion 360 offers a personal use license that allows individuals to use the software for non-commercial purposes free of charge. This makes it an excellent choice for hobbyists and makers.

4. Can Fusion 360 work offline? While Fusion 360 is primarily cloud-based, it does offer offline capabilities. However, some features may be limited or unavailable when working offline. It’s advisable to have a stable internet connection for the best experience.
5. Are there alternatives to Fusion 360? Yes, there are other CAD software options available, such as SolidWorks, AutoCAD, and Onshape. Each software has its own strengths and target audience. It’s recommended to explore different options and choose the one that aligns best with your specific needs and preferences.
